What did you think of the banquet table the King hosted?
Here’s some reasons why it looks the way it does.
Banquet Guests DO NOT talk across the table which is over six feet wide.
The flowers are huge in proportion to the table and the enormity of the room. Since HM King Charles Ill became Monarch he has decided the flowers should be British and arranged naturally only in water and wire mesh, to be eco compliant.
They are now arranged by a team of enthusiastic and talented arrangers based at Buckingham Palace.

What does a professional florist see in this pic? The symbolism of the flowers, the construction techniques and the incredible NDA agreement that went with it!
So here’s a list of some of the symbolism in the design, because every Swiftie loves a back story to the love story. And ok, I’m sentimental and love anyone’s love story.

Roses-
Roses, especially when considering their colors, hold diverse symbolic meanings. In general, roses symbolize love, beauty, and passion.
White roses often represent purity, innocence, and new beginnings. Pink roses can signify grace, admiration, and gratitude.
Anemone-
Sometimes considered symbols of love and affection, especially in Victorian flower language. In ancient Greek tales, they sprung from the blood of Adonis mingled with the tears of Aphrodite, his lover.
Hydrangea-
various meanings, often depending on culture and color, generally representing heartfelt emotion, gratitude, apology, and abundance.
In Japan, it signifies sincere feelings and apology, while in Europe, it was once associated with arrogance and boastfulness, a sentiment now faded.
The color of the hydrangea adds specific layers to its meaning, with pink signifying love, blue representing gratitude and regret, white symbolizing purity and grace.
Allium-
Good fortune: Alliums are universally loved, not just by us humans but also by bees, butterflies and other insects, particularly when planted as part of a group. This is why they have come to symbolise good fortune - they bring joy, together.
Delphiniums-
‘big hearted’. Like many flowers, different colours of delphiniums often carry their own significance.
Nerines-
Pink nerines symbolize love, beauty, and strength, representing a powerful love from the heart, while also signifying resilience and the ability to overcome hardship, like the Guernsey Lily that survived a shipwreck. Additionally, their connection to Greek mythology links them to sea nymphs and protection for sailors, reflecting themes of freedom, connection, and affection.

Trends that come and go.
Fruit back on trend. Highlights table arrangements and offers texture. Great for an event or impact piece.

Fruit will shorten the lifespan of flowers, fruits release ethylene gas, which accelerates the aging process in flowers, leading to premature wilting and fading
